This document discusses congestion control and Quality of Service (QoS) improvement in the Adaptive Energy Efficient Routing (AEERG) protocol for Mobile Ad Hoc Networks (MANETs) by evaluating four queuing disciplines: FIFO, Priority Queuing (PQ), Random Early Detection (RED), and Weighted Fair Queuing (WFQ). The authors present NS-2 simulation results comparing these techniques based on queuing delay, packet drop rate, and end-to-end delay. The findings highlight the effectiveness of different queuing mechanisms in managing network traffic and improving reliability and performance.
